The Gaza flotilla and the Dutch Activists

The release of the three Dutch⁣ activists, reported by CTV news, marks a de-escalation in a situation ​that frequently leads to prolonged detention. ‍ The⁣ flotilla, organized‍ by the Freedom flotilla‌ Coalition, aims to deliver humanitarian aid to Gaza, which has been under a blockade imposed by Israel and Egypt as 2007. Israel maintains the blockade⁤ is ‍necessary for security reasons, preventing weapons from reaching Hamas, the militant group controlling Gaza. Activists argue the blockade‌ constitutes collective punishment of the Gazan population.

Details surrounding the interception and detention⁢ remain contested. Israeli authorities claim the interception was peaceful and necessary to enforce the​ blockade. activists allege excessive force was used during the boarding of their vessels. the released‍ activists are expected to return to their home countries, and the incident is likely⁣ to fuel further criticism ​of Israel’s policies.

Legal and Political Context

The legality of Israel’s blockade of Gaza is a contentious issue‌ under international law. Critics argue it violates international humanitarian law, specifically the principles of proportionality ​and distinction. Israel defends the blockade as‌ a legitimate ⁢security measure, citing the threat posed by Hamas. The detentions of activists raise questions about freedom of navigation and the right to⁢ peaceful protest.

The incidents‌ also highlight the​ complex political dynamics surrounding the israeli-Palestinian conflict.The flotilla attempts are often seen as symbolic acts of defiance against⁤ Israeli policies, while Israel views them‍ as provocations designed to undermine its security.
